IOT Manager
The Manager, Industrial OT is responsible for the strategy, governance, and enterprise delivery of connected‑operations capabilities across the company’s U.S. sawmill and OSB facilities. This role partners with Operations, Maintenance, Engineering, Finance and IT to improve network infrastructure, security, data acquisition, storage, retrieval, processing and analytics to ensure fast, accurate real‑time visibility, enable advanced analytical tools, improve information exchange with internal and external resources while enhancing and strengthening safety, reliability, uptime, and cost performance. The position oversees a team of OT technicians and application specialists and is accountable for portfolio prioritization, standards, and value realization across multiple sites as well as executing on the OT roadmap. This role is also responsible for evaluating, selecting and managing contracts and relations with service providers to create and improve strategic relationships, secure service continuity while managing contractual engagements and financial obligations.

West Fraser is a diversified wood products company producing lumber, OSB, LVL, MDF, plywood, pulp, newsprint, wood chips, and energy with over 60 facilities in Canada, the United States, and Europe. We are the largest lumber producer in North America, a leading global manufacturer of wood-based panels, and the world’s largest producer of oriented strand board (OSB).
